BTW - If I were in your predicament, not being as mech inclined as many of the above - I would do a few oil changes w/ marvel mystery oil in there. Run and dump oil. Get moisture out. Compression test to make sure is OK, 'pickle it' fuel side and oil. Then get new manifolds and install - start her up ASAP, run for a awhile, then winterize again...
